Output 28fdaa91c265de5efbcfb17bcbb151fdea72209f3cbfbc4583a25a899d60bafd:0

value
20226800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2cf33ec600d4b75b2bee6b0490391d8f1af28cc OP_EQUALVERIFY OP_CHECKSIG
address
1Jm4JvMFKBFGuyueHbGRYRVjW8UtZ1rAjx
transaction
28fdaa91c265de5efbcfb17bcbb151fdea72209f3cbfbc4583a25a899d60bafd
confirmations
523621
spent
true